Sharon Francis Foundation is a charitable organization based in Toronto, Ontario, classified by the CRA under supportive health care. In its fiscal year ending December 31, 2024, it reported $10K in revenue and $95K in expenditures. Spending exceeded revenue that year — the gap came out of reserves.
Its funding that year was roughly 100% from donations. In 2024, 1 other registered charity reported granting it a combined $96.
Compared with 1,620 health charities of similar size, its share of spending on mission — charitable programs plus grants to other charities — ranked above 27% of peers. Its highest-paid position fell in the $40,000–79,999 range. The charity reported 1 permanent full-time position.
Revenue has declined over its filings on record here, from $135K in 2020 to $10K in 2024. Its filed list of directors and trustees shows 4 names.
In its own words
The Foundation’s charitable purposes are: (i) To advance education by conducting and/or funding research in the field of medicine including regenerative medicine and disseminating the result of the research to the public (ii) To receive and maintain a fund or funds and to apply all or part of the principal and income therefrom from time to time to qualified donees as defined in subsection 149.1 (1) of the Income Tax Act (Canada); and (iii) To undertake activities ancillary and incidental to the attainment of the above purposes
Ongoing-program description from its T3010 filing, verbatim.
The ledger, 2020–2024
| Year | Revenue | Spending | Programs | Fundraising | Gifts out | Net assets |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| $10K | $95K | $63K | — | — | $134K |
| 2023 | $232K | $570K | — | $158K | $50K | $219K |
| 2022 | $131K | $303K | $75K | — | $150K | $557K |
| 2021 | $148K | $297K | $43K | — | $10K | $730K |
| 2020 | $135K | $269K | — | — | — | $880K |
Revenue printed in red where the year ran a deficit. Fiscal years by period end.
